I have had my EOS R5 for over six years now and everything is still very complicated. When I turn it on it will no longer take photos. There are some things flashing that I do not know what they mean and have tried for hours to get it to work. I have even tried completely resetting everything back to the original way but that does not work. What is shown now is a flashing little red image of the camera also with 1/25 below it. Can anyone help me get this camera working again?

Hi coolerator,
Going by the description of the icons you are seeing it sounds like the touch shutter may be enabled. If the 1/25 you are seeing is in the bottom left of the LCD that is the shutter speed. The camera icon directly above it is to show if the touch shutter is enabled.
When touch shutter is enabled the camera is expecting you to touch the rear LCD to take a photo. To disable that touch the camera icon near the bottom left of the screen. When touch shutter is disabled the camera icon in the bottom left of the screen will say Off on it. When you see that you can use the shutter button on the camera to take a photo.
